The $840 Million Mistake: Programmer Has Only 2 Password Guesses Left Before Bitcoin Vanishes

The stakes couldn't be higher for programmer Stefan Thomas, who is currently locked out of a massive fortune. Thomas holds an IronKey USB drive containing the private keys to 7,002 Bitcoins, but he has already exhausted eight of his ten permitted password attempts before the device triggers a permanent self-destruct sequence.
This high-stakes situation underscores the unforgiving nature of self-custody and the critical importance of hardware security. Should Thomas fail his final two attempts, an estimated $840 million worth of Bitcoin will be permanently deleted from the blockchain, highlighting the extreme risks associated with managing private keys and encrypted storage devices.
With eight attempts already used, Thomas is down to his final two guesses. If he fails, a fortune valued at roughly $840 million will be lost to the void forever. This ongoing saga serves as a stark warning to the crypto community regarding the volatility of hardware wallets and the absolute necessity of foolproof backup strategies.
